入选标准
- •Male and female adults willing to comply with the requirements of the study and providing a signed written informed consent
- •Consent the use of facial images for marketing purposes and educational material
- •Subject with moderate to very severe (Grade 2 to 4) on the GJS
- •Subject is willing to abstain from any other facial, submental, and/or neck aesthetic procedure(s) or implant
- •Female of childbearing potential with a negative urine pregnancy test before treatment
排除标准
- •Subjects presenting with known/previous allergy or hypersensitivity to hyaluronic acid (HA) filler, lidocaine or other amide-type local anesthetics
- •Subjects presenting with known/previous allergy or hypersensitivity to streptococcal proteins
- •Subject with bleeding disorders or taking thrombolytics or anticoagulants
- •Prior surgical procedure in the treatment area
- •History of other facial treatment/procedure in the previous 6 months HA in or near the intended treatment site
- •Presence of any disease or lesions near or on the area to be treated
- •Presence of any condition, in the opinion of the Treating Investigator, makes the subject unable to complete the study per protocol
- •Women who are pregnant or breast feeding, or women of childbearing potential who are not practicing adequate contraception or planning to become pregnant during the study period
- •Study site personnel, close relatives of the study site personnel, employees, or close relatives of employees at the Sponsor Company
- •Participation in any other interventional clinical study within 30 days before treatment
结局指标
主要结局
Percentage of Responders Having At Least a 1-Grade Improvement From Baseline on Both Jawlines Concurrently Based on Galderma Jawline Scale (GJS) at Month 3 as Assessed by Blinded Evaluator
时间窗: Baseline, Month 3
The GJS is a validated 5-point scale (ranges 0-4) for assessment of the jawline. Each score in the GJS is represented by photographic images of the scale, where 0 = none to minimal, 1 = mild, 2 = moderate, 3 = severe and 4 = very severe volume deficiency posterior to the jowl along the jawline. The Blinded Evaluator performed live assessment of the participant's left and right jawline separately. Here, a higher score indicated more volume deficiency in the treatment area. A responder was defined as participants having at least a 1-grade improvement from baseline on both jawlines concurrently.
